What happens to my SNAP benefits if I don't use them?

If you receive SNAP, and do not use all of your allotted benefits each month, they will roll over and be combined with the next month's benefits. You will not lose them. SNAP benefits will, however, be permanently removed after a period of one year has passed without the card having been used.

How long do SNAP benefits last in Texas?

Most benefit periods last for 6 months but some can be as short as 1 month or as long as 3 years. For most adults between the ages of 18 and 50 who do not have a child in the home, SNAP benefits are limited to 3 months in a 3-year period.

Can I use my Texas SNAP card in another state?

You have a right to use your SNAP in all 50 states. SNAP is a federal program that is “interoperable” between states.

How do I get cash from my food stamp card?

Step 1 Insert or swipe your card at the ATM. Step 2 Enter your four-number Personal Identification Number (PIN) on the keypad and press the “OK” or “ENTER” key. Step 3 Select “WITHDRAW CASH” and then select “CHECKING.” (Some ATMs may use different words.)

How often do you get your snap benefits?

SNAP benefits will be put into your account once a month. The last number in your SNAP Eligibility Determination Group number tells what day you get your benefits.

What if I don't use all my benefits in one month?

You won't lose your benefits if you don't use them all in one month. Benefits you don't use stay in your account for a year from the date they are put into your account. The next time benefits are put into your account, they are added to what is still in there.

Can you use Snap to buy food?

You can't use SNAP to buy alcoholic drinks, tobacco products, hot food or any food sold to eat in the store. You also can't use SNAP to buy items that are not food, such as soap, paper products, medicines, vitamins, supplies for the home, grooming items, pet food and cosmetics.

Can someone else get a Lone Star Card so they can buy items for me?

If you need someone else to help you buy things, you should ask for a second card to give to someone you trust. The money that person spends on the second card will come out of your Lone Star Card account.

Can you get back your snap if you didn't report?

However, if you're convicted of fraud or should not have received benefits due to a change you failed to report, your benefits may be taken back or you may be forced to repay them. Since each state administers its own SNAP program, the specific rules and requirements for repayment may vary.

Do you lose food stamps at the end of the month?

Fortunately, you won't lose any food stamps that are left over at the end of the month. Any balance remaining on your Electronic Benefit Transfer, or EBT, card will roll over to the following month. Your benefits won't be adjusted or reduced because you aren't using the full amount every month.
